3.2.2
Multiplexed signals
As stated more times in the previous paragraphs, most of the signals available on the Qseven® Card Edge Connector can be reprogrammed to implement
different functionalities, according to the i.MX6 pin-multiplexing possibilities.
For this reason, in the following table is shown a complete list of all the multiplexing possibilities offered by this module.
The signals are grouped in logical ports, where each logical port represents one of the standard functionalities (if applicable) of the Qseven modules. Please be
aware that sometimes the multiplexing can lead to conflicts (i.e., the same functionality is available on 2 or more logical ports). This situation is evidenced in the last
column of the following table.
When the i.MX6 Signal is marked in bold italic (like
WAKE#
), it means that the standard function is managed through SECO BSP, it is not native of the i.MX6
processor.
